NEW YORK -- A construction worker fell about 40 stories to his death yesterday at a Manhattan skyscraper being built by the developer of the World Trade Center, authorities said.
The man, identified as Anthony Esposito, a rigger on a crew dismantling a crane, fell either from the crane or a 20-foot, moveable walkway linking it to the glass-walled skyscraper.
The accident happened on West 42nd Street, where developer Larry Silverstein is building two 60-story luxury apartment buildings.
